Ash wednesday is the first day of lent in the western christian church

It occurs six and a half weeks before easter and marks the beginning of the penitential lenten season. Should a christian observe ash wednesday

Since the bible nowhere explicitly commands or condemns such a practice, christians are at liberty to prayerfully decide whether or not to observe ash wednesday If a christian decides to observe ash wednesday and/or lent, it is important to have a biblical perspective. In western christianity, ash wednesday marks the first day or the start of the season of lent Officially named day of ashes, ash wednesday always falls 40 days before easter (sundays are not included in the count)

Lent is a time when christians prepare for easter by observing a period of fasting, repentance, moderation, giving up of sinful habits, and spiritual discipline.
